Revolvers for Concealed Carry by zeebiggprophecy in liberalgunowners

[–]TurnoverSubject4572 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I carry a S&W 637. It’s so small and light I can carry it in any weather, season, clothing etc. because I can comfortably carry it IWB or pocket. For me that’s the number 1 criteria for a CCW is I will actually carry it every day and everywhere. It’s accurate enough within 15ft god forbid it needs to be used on anything other than paper.
